Output d5516d85a83df8960e3c3803aa4dcfae8935e4feec71cb350a251a96c468b913:40

value
99505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b87740bcead625f809e8a7ba0cc6cb8cc8c8c72 OP_EQUAL
address
32jyd7bWvREHcJDPgFWZj11wkvYqc4mGJC
transaction
d5516d85a83df8960e3c3803aa4dcfae8935e4feec71cb350a251a96c468b913
spent
true